Congress extends deadline to Jan. 1, 2026 for ownership reporting by companies formed before 2024
Also known as: Protect Small Businesses from Excessive Paperwork Act of 2025

4 articlesHouse Passes Bill to Extend BOI Reporting Deadline
Covers the House passage of H.R. 736 and explains it would extend the CTA beneficial ownership information (BOI) deadline to Jan. 1, 2026 for companies formed before Jan. 1, 2024.
